Psychiatric institutions around the world
Photographs by Eugene Richards

Basic human rights often seem not to apply to the mentally ill or mentally retarded. This was the conclusion of photographer Eugene Richards, who wandered the world to document the animalistic conditions of psychiatric institutions in Paraguay, Armenia, Mexico, Hungary and Kosovo for his new book, A Procession of Them . Most of these institutions mix patients together without regard for condition or temperament, leaving the dangerous ones free to prey upon other patients, including children and even a few perfectly sane castaways, who simply have nowhere else to go. Some of the worst abuses are being reined in, thanks to the efforts of Mental Disability Rights International (MDRI). Here, at a facility in Asuncion, Paraguay, nearly 50 residents hold their mattresses in a courtyard while their rooms are hosed down.
